    The Language of Blocks Part I - Stack, Row, Arch

    When children intentionally create block structures they are, in effect, making statements about the spatial relations among the blocks. On top, next to, between, and covering are some of the relations that block structures can represent. We might want to give the structures names, like arch, row, or stack; but…
